Federal Contracting in Arizona
The federal government awards billions of dollars in contracts each year to businesses across the United States. Arizona is home to numerous federal agencies, military installations, and government facilities that regularly post contract opportunities on SAM.gov. Small businesses in AZ can compete for these contracts, especially through set-aside programs like 8(a), HUBZone, SDVOSB, and WOSB.

How to Find Arizona Contracts
Federal contracts with performance locations in Arizona are posted on SAM.gov, the government's official procurement portal. To compete for federal contracts in Arizona, your business should be registered in SAM.gov with an active entity registration. If you hold small business certifications, you may be eligible for set-aside contracts that limit competition to certified businesses, giving you a significant advantage.
